The Righthaven LLC copyright infringement litigation took a bizarre turn Monday when Righthaven's court-appointed receiver moved to fire Righthaven CEO Steven Gibson.
The receiver, Lake Tahoe-area attorney Lara Pearson, filed papers in federal court in Las Vegas saying Gibson has been taking actions to harm the company, that she is terminating him and that she plans to have Righthaven sue him for malpractice.
Gibson didn't say Monday if he would formally contest Pearsons actions, but he made it clear he opposes them.
"I do not think it appropriate to litigate this matter in the press, but you can note that there is certainly disagreement," said Gibson, a Las Vegas attorney.
Las Vegas-based Righthaven is a partnership between Gibson and an affiliate of Stephens Media LLC, owner of the Las Vegas Review-Journal.
